Before we dive into the movie itself, let’s talk about the man behind the madness: Adam Sandler. Born on September 9, 1966, in Brooklyn, New York, Adam Sandler grew up in Manchester, New Hampshire. He began his career in stand-up comedy before joining the cast of Saturday Night Live (SNL) in 1990. It wasn’t long before he became a household name, thanks to his signature characters like Opera Man and The Gap Girl.
